yeah, it does sound like you played it really softly. It's not the level issue, meaning even if i turned the volume all the way up, it still sounds like someone played it softly, and the fact hats are almost as loud, if not louder than the snare.

AL
 
I don't think that playing hard necessarily adds more emotion (although in some cases I suppose it could). In this case I think its really about the sound of drum changing as you hit it harder. All I can really hear in your toms, etc. it the top head resonating on its own - no/little resonance from the drum itself hence no body to the drum sounds. The kick drum needs to be tuned better, it sounds pretty weak.

Where did you have your three mics positioned? That would be the next thing to experiment with a little.
